Understanding Forex Trading

Forex trading, short for foreign exchange trading, involves buying and selling currencies. It’s one of the most liquid and dynamic markets globally. The forex market operates 24 hours a day, five days a week, enabling traders to react swiftly to news and events. Unlike stock markets, forex trading is decentralised, meaning there is no central exchange. Instead, trading happens over the counter (OTC) through a network of banks, brokers, and financial institutions.

Key Tools and Platforms

To trade forex live, you need a reliable trading platform. These platforms provide real-time charts, technical analysis tools, and live price quotes. MetaTrader 4 (MT4) and MetaTrader 5 (MT5) are popular choices among traders. They offer user-friendly interfaces and a range of features to enhance your trading experience. Additionally, many platforms support automated trading strategies, allowing you to execute trades based on pre-set criteria.

Importance of Risk Management

Risk management is crucial in live forex trading. The forex market’s high volatility can lead to significant gains but also substantial losses. Effective risk management strategies help protect your capital and minimise losses. One common technique is setting stop-loss orders. These orders automatically close a trade if the market moves against you by a certain amount. Additionally, never risk more than a small percentage of your trading capital on a single trade.

The Role of Technical Analysis

Technical analysis plays a key role in live forex trading. It involves analysing historical price data to predict future movements. Traders use various technical indicators, such as moving averages, RSI, and MACD, to identify trends and potential entry and exit points. Chart patterns, like head and shoulders or double tops, also provide valuable insights. By mastering technical analysis, you can make more informed trading decisions and improve your chances of success.

Fundamental Analysis in Forex Trading

While technical analysis focuses on price data, fundamental analysis examines economic indicators and news events. Key factors influencing currency prices include interest rates, inflation, and GDP growth. Central bank announcements and geopolitical events can also have significant impacts. By staying informed about global economic trends, you can better anticipate market movements and make more strategic trades.
